Transaction 140dc89d5b5203e01f7358718b54ec3339ea268b94a28193442fea899ec5e0ca

2 Input
2 Outputs
  • 140dc89d5b5203e01f7358718b54ec3339ea268b94a28193442fea899ec5e0ca:0
  • value  1009833
    address  3PviwwswCJRdAFLx74skK3vjVVxf5Ytt4i
  • 140dc89d5b5203e01f7358718b54ec3339ea268b94a28193442fea899ec5e0ca:1
  • value  492860
    address  152dH86UEPzCpp1HZLTj3MkRbrKY8zvBxN